DESCRIPTION:“a swinging\, expressive improviser… masterpiece” – All Music\n  \nJoshua Redman is one of the most acclaimed and charismatic jazz artists working today. Joshua was born in Berkeley\, California\, and he is the son of legendary saxophonist Dewey Redman and dancer Renee Shedroff. He was exposed at an early age to a variety of music (jazz\, classical\, rock\, soul\, Indian\, Indonesian\, Middle-Eastern\, African). Also\, a wide range of instruments (recorder\, piano\, guitar\, gatham\, gamelan). Then\, Redman began playing clarinet at age nine before switching to the tenor saxophone one year later.  \nJohn Coltrane\, Ornette Coleman\, Cannonball Adderley and his father\, Dewey Redman influenced Redman early on. Also\, The Beatles\, Aretha Franklin\, the Temptations\, Earth\, Wind and Fire\, Prince\, The Police and Led Zeppelin drew Joshua more deeply into music. Joshua loved playing saxophone and was a member of the award-winning Berkeley High School Jazz Ensemble and Combo from 1983-86. However\, he always put academics first\, and he never seriously considered becoming a professional musician. \nIn 1991 Redman graduated from Harvard College summa cum laude\, with a B.A. in Social Studies. He had already been accepted by Yale Law School\, but deferred entrance for what he believed was only going to be one year. Then\, Redman won the prestigious Thelonious Monk International Saxophone Competition\, propelling him to near-certain stardom. \nOver the past three decades\, the saxophonist\, composer\, and bandleader has consistently demonstrated how to honor music’s verities while expanding its reach in contemporary settings.
